7.7 Setting input timing

You can set input timing of analog input video if signal is input.
Since the MSD loads the optimal table from the built-in tables and adjusts the input timing automatically, you
do not need to set this menu. However, if signal which are not registered in the MSD tables are input or if part
of the output video is cut off by using the standard table registered in the MSD, set the input timing manually.
For digital inputs, you do not need to set the input timing, but if part of the video is cut off, adjust the input
timing finely.

7.7.1 Automatic measurement
Menu
Top→INPUT TIMING→AUTO SETUP
Setting for
Each input/input signal
Setting value
・NORMAL MODE [Default]
・NEXT ASPECT
Analog RGB/analog YPbPr input video is measured to set "7.7.2 The total number of horizontal dots",
"7.7.3 Start position", "7.7.4 Active area", and "7.7.9 Tracking" automatically.
Normally, select "NORMAL MODE" (Automatic measurement of start position and active area). If edges of
video are not displayed correctly, use this mode to set the start position and active area automatically.
If the total number of horizontal dots is not correct, the aspect ratio is not matched even though automatic
measurement is set to perform with the "NORMAL MODE". In this case, select "NEXT ASPECT" (Auto
measurement taking into account aspect ratio) for the measurement function. If the aspect ratio of the input
signal is known, you can directly specify the aspect ratio to correctly perform the automatic measurement.
If input signal is not registered in the MSD, use this function.
